在Heroku上部署战争所需的步骤

时间:2012-03-29 10:22:54

标签: java heroku

我有Maven的spring源工具。我有一个Java项目,我想在Heroku上部署。 任何人都可以告诉我在Heroku上部署的步骤吗?

非常感谢

4 个答案:

答案 0 :(得分:11)

  1. 在Maven中创建 war 文件。您可以参考here
  2. 来执行此操作
  3. here
  4. 安装Heroku Toolbelt
  5. 打开命令提示符(对于Windows)并键入$heroku login
    它会提示输入用户名和密码。输入您的heroku帐户的凭据。
  6. 现在,要安装 heroku-deploy 插件,请输入代码:
    $ heroku plugins:install heroku-cli-deploy
  7. 现在通过以下代码将 war 文件部署到 heroku服务器
    $ heroku deploy:war --war <path_to_war_file> --app <app_name>
  8. 如果您在应用程序目录中,则可以省略--app参数:
    $ heroku deploy:war --war <path_to_war_file>
  9. 您的应用程序将成功部署到heroku服务器。

答案 1 :(得分:4)

这里有很好的解释:

https://devcenter.heroku.com/articles/java

答案 2 :(得分:1)

如何将war文件部署到Heroku

  • 注册Heroku帐户
  • 安装heroku-cli
  • 根据需要安装JDK
  • 使用命令heroku plugins:install heroku-cli-deploy
  • 安装heroku-cli-deploy插件
  • 使用命令行登录heroku:heroku login
  • 使用命令创建应用:heroku apps:create <app_name>
  • 使用以下命令部署war文件:heroku war:deploy <path_to_war_file> --app <app_name>
  • 使用命令打开应用程序:heroku open -a <app_name>

参考

答案 3 :(得分:0)

此网址显示如何在heroku上部署war文件:

https://github.com/heroku/heroku-deploy

相关问题